The 1990s witnessed a confrontation between international organizations trying to work in Egypt and law 32/1964, preventing founding NGOs receiving foreign finances. Since most of the activists are lawyers, they began digging inside the body of the law to find legal ways of doing this. Tens of NGOs...

The public expected Iqra’ [recite, the very first word revealed in the Qur’an] satellite channel to offer an enlightened reading of Islam to agree with the givens of the new globalization time. However, the channel ended up by becoming the official channel for extremists and stagnant jurisprudence.
